Running yarn upgrade without any modifiers does not update package. json . If we run yarn upgrade without any flags, it will install the latest version that matches the version pattern indicated by package. json .
How do I update package JSON with yarn?
If you have pass yarn the –latest flag it will update the package. json. NOTE: this will not respect semver and will update to the latest version. Whatever that might be.
How do you update yarn packages?
- yarn add. When you want to use another package, you first need to add it to your dependencies. …
- yarn tag. Tags are a way of publishing versions of your package with a label. …
- Versions of dependencies. Packages in Yarn follow Semantic Versioning, also known as “semver”. …
- yarn upgrade-interactive.
Does yarn install update dependencies?
yarn install is used to install all dependencies for a project. This is most commonly used when you have just checked out code for a project, or when another developer on the project has added a new dependency that you need to pick up. … These have been replaced by yarn add and yarn add –dev .
How does yarn upgrade work?
When using yarn to manage NPM dependencies, a yarn. lock file is generated automatically. Also any time a dependency is added, removed, or modified with the yarn CLI (e.g. running the yarn install command), the yarn. lock file will update automatically.
Does yarn need package JSON?
Yarn does not support npm shrinkwrap files as they don’t have enough information in them to power Yarn’s more deterministic algorithm. If you are using a shrinkwrap file it may be easier to convert everyone working on the project to use Yarn at the same time.
How do I change the yarn version?
You can use homebrew and yarn formula URLs to install older versions of yarn, then brew switch between yarn versions as needed. Works perfectly! Credit to github user robertmorgan. First off, if you already have a version installed, unlink it from brew running the brew unlink yarn command in your terminal.
What is yarn latest version?
Running yarn version would look something like this: info Current version: 1.0. 2 Running tests for version 1.0.
When the yarn version command is run it will also run the usual lifecycle methods in the following order:
- yarn preversion.
- yarn version.
- yarn postversion.
How do I update NPM to latest version of yarn?
You can try this npm package yarn-upgrade-all . This package will remove every package in package. json and add it again which will update it to latest version.
How do I update my react version?
You need to go back to your Terminal or Command Prompt and run npm update at the root of your project folder to ensure the new changes get picked up: Once the update step has finished, you can continue working on your project and testing your app like you normally would. Lastly, when specifying the version in package.
Can I remove yarn lock?
The short answer is No, you must not delete the package-lock or yarn-lock file, it is crucial for your project to work and compiled successfully without trouble.
How do you upgrade all dependencies in yarn?
just run yarn upgrade-interactive –latest and select packages you want to update using space button and press the enter to update. If your dependencies are using a range version ( “^x.x.x” , “~x.x.x” , etc), your package. json won’t be updated if the latest version also match that range, only your yarn.
How can I speed up installing yarn?
Speed up NPM/Yarn install in Gitlab
- Cache download takes about 1 minute.
- Cache create 4 minutes (zipping of hundreds of thousands files)
- Cache upload 1 minutes.
- Bare Yarn install 3 minutes.
- Yarn install on top of cache 1 minute.
Does yarn use package lock?
How do I upgrade the yarn in Windows?
In order to update your version of Yarn, you can run one of the following commands:
- npm install –global yarn – if you’ve installed Yarn via npm (recommended)
- otherwise, check the docs of the installer you’ve used to install Yarn.
Does yarn need lock?
It’s less clear whether lock files should always be committed into packages that are intended to be included in other projects (where looser dependencies are desirable). However, both Yarn and NPM (as covered by @Cyrille) intelligently ignore yarn. … So you should always commit at least one of yarn. lock or package-lock.